Garret Dillahunt Joins DCU Series in Major Role

The Lanterns cast continues to grow, with Deadline reporting that Fear the Walking Dead star Garret Dillahunt has joined the DCU show in a major recurring role.

According to Deadline’s report, Dillahunt will play the role of William Macon, a “modern cowboy” that is described as “a self-righteous, conspiracy-minded man who masks his ruthless ambition behind a charming and calculated facade.”

Dillahunt is best known for his roles in the hit dramas Deadwood and Fear the Walking Dead. He has also starred in a number of other high-profile projects, including No Country for Old Men, ER, The 4400, The Assassination of Jesse James by the Coward Robert Ford, Winter’s Bone, Looper, and 12 Years a Slave.

Who else is in the Lanterns cast?

The Lanterns cast will star Aaron Pierre as John Stewart alongside Kyle Chandler, who has been cast in the series as Hal Jordan in the upcoming series. A separate report from THR notes that HBO looks to begin filming from January to June next year, so more information should come soon.

Other confirmed cast members for the series include Kelly Macdonald, who will play a character known as Sheriff Kerry in the series.

Lanterns will be executive produced by Chris Mundy (True Detective: Night Country, Ozark), Damon Lindelof (The Leftovers, Watchmen), and Tom King (Supergirl: Woman of Tomorrow), with the latter two also co-writing the series. It received an official straight-to-series-order at HBO last June 2024, more than a year since the 8-episode project was first announced back in January 2023.

“The series follows new recruit John Stewart and Lantern legend Hal Jordan, two intergalactic cops drawn into a dark, earth-based mystery as they investigate a murder in the American heartland,” the synopsis for the show reads.
